First off, let's talk about what flexibility means in the context of aluminum gutter coils. Flexibility refers to the ability of the coil to bend and shape without cracking or breaking. This is crucial because gutters need to be able to conform to the shape of your roof and the angles of your house. If the gutter coil isn't flexible enough, it won't fit properly, which can lead to leaks, clogs, and other problems down the road.
One of the main advantages of aluminum gutter coils is their inherent flexibility. Aluminum is a soft and malleable metal, which means it can be easily bent and shaped to fit just about any roofline. Whether you have a simple, straight roof or a complex, multi - angled design, aluminum gutter coils can be customized to meet your specific needs.
Another reason why flexibility is so important is that it allows for easier installation. When you're installing gutters, you often need to make bends and curves to navigate around obstacles like downspouts, vents, and windows. With a flexible aluminum gutter coil, you can make these adjustments on the fly, without having to worry about the coil breaking or splitting. This not only saves you time but also reduces the risk of installation errors.
Let's take a closer look at how the flexibility of aluminum gutter coils is achieved. The manufacturing process plays a big role in determining the flexibility of the coil. At our facility, we use state - of - the - art rolling and annealing techniques to ensure that our aluminum gutter coils have the right balance of strength and flexibility. Annealing is a heat - treating process that softens the aluminum, making it more pliable without sacrificing its structural integrity.
The thickness of the aluminum also affects its flexibility. Thinner coils are generally more flexible than thicker ones. However, you need to find the right balance between flexibility and durability. If the coil is too thin, it may not be strong enough to withstand the elements and the weight of the water and debris in the gutter. On the other hand, if it's too thick, it may be difficult to bend and shape. Our team of experts can help you choose the right thickness for your specific application.
Now, let's talk about some real - world applications of the flexibility of aluminum gutter coils. One common use is in residential roofing. Many homeowners choose aluminum gutters because they are lightweight, corrosion - resistant, and easy to install. The flexibility of the coils allows them to be installed on a variety of roof styles, from traditional pitched roofs to modern flat roofs.
In commercial buildings, the flexibility of aluminum gutter coils is also highly valued. Commercial roofs often have complex designs and multiple levels, which require gutters that can be customized to fit. Aluminum gutter coils can be bent and shaped to create seamless gutters that are both functional and aesthetically pleasing.

The flexibility of aluminum gutter coils also has environmental benefits. Because aluminum is a recyclable material, using flexible aluminum gutter coils means that you're making a more sustainable choice. When the gutters reach the end of their lifespan, they can be recycled and used to make new products, reducing the amount of waste in landfills.
In addition to its flexibility, aluminum gutter coils offer other advantages. They are highly resistant to corrosion, which means they can last for decades without rusting or deteriorating. This is especially important in areas with high humidity or saltwater exposure. Aluminum is also lightweight, which makes it easier to handle and transport. This can save you money on shipping costs and reduce the risk of injury during installation.
When it comes to maintenance, the flexibility of aluminum gutter coils can also be a plus. If you need to make repairs or adjustments to your gutters over time, you can easily bend and reshape the coil to fix any issues. This is much easier than trying to repair or replace a rigid gutter system.
